Role Summary

National Life Group® is a purpose-driven organization with a mission to Do good. Be good. Make good. We are committed to fostering a culture of inclusion, belonging, and diversity where all associates can thrive.

In this role, you will provide administrative support to the Operations team on our Vermont campus. This role will interface with all levels of leadership across the organization. Strong organization, prioritization, discretionary judgment, communication, time management skills, and the ability to manage multiple priorities are critical to this role. Mentorship and professional development opportunities will be provided to support your growth.

This position offers a hybrid work schedule requiring onsite presence four (4) days per week, Monday through Thursday, based on current core days. Schedule expectations may change with advanced notification and manager discretion.

Essential Duties And Responsibilities
  • Act as ambassador and spokesperson, both formally and informally, by building rapport between the leadership team and all business areas; position plays a critical role in the overall effectiveness of relationship management, acting as partner and point‑person to coordinate and facilitate communication.
  • Draft communication as needed; collaborate with leadership on messaging and managing information flow.
  • Arrange travel, accommodations, itineraries and all correspondence related to necessary arrangements including management of expense reports.
  • Plan, organize and execute events such as meetings, team building activities, luncheons, client dinners and special projects.
  • Maintain files, records, and correspondence for meetings.
  • Prepare information and research for senior leadership needs.
  • Prepare presentations and related materials.
  • Develop a foundational understanding of National Life Group & Operations business models and decision‑making processes.
  • Assist in the onboarding and offboarding of business area associates.
  • Work collaboratively with other administrative professionals and contribute to the success of the team.
  • Other duties as assigned by leadership, including participation on special projects and specific committees as needed to meet business needs.
Minimum Qualifications
  • Bachelor’s degree in Business Administration or related field; equivalent years of job experience or certification.
  • Minimum of 5 years of senior‑level administrative professional experience.
  • High level interpersonal skills to handle sensitive and confidential situations; requires demonstrated poise, tact and diplomacy and ability to interact effectively at all levels.
  • Display a high level of initiative, anticipate needs of the leadership.
  • Strong organizational skills that reflect ability to perform and prioritize multiple tasks seamlessly with excellent quality and attention to detail.
  • Must be willing and able to work more than a 40‑hour work week if necessary.
  • Strategic mindset as well as strong critical thinking and project coordination skills.
  • Experience supporting leadership in a fast‑paced corporate environment preferred.
  • Must be able to pass a background check.
